Spring Repair
Spring repair in Oak Park runs $180-$340. Original torsion springs from the 1980s and 1990s are fracturing now because they’ve simply reached cycle limits, and Oak Park’s dry fire-season conditions accelerate metal fatigue when cracked weatherstripping lets heat and grit into the coil housing. We replace both springs even when only one breaks, because matched pairs balance door tension and prevent premature opener strain. Most spring jobs in Oak Park take 45 minutes.

Track Realignment
Track realignment costs $120-$240 in Oak Park. The Santa Ana winds that funnel through this Ventura County valley corridor torque track brackets out of square, especially on two-car doors with wide spans. A door that binds, reverses unexpectedly, or has jumped its rollers is often a track geometry problem, not an opener problem. We square the vertical and horizontal sections, check jamb bracket integrity, and test full travel before leaving. Wind-season calls spike October through February.

Panel Replacement
Panel replacement in Oak Park runs $250-$500 per section, but here’s where local knowledge becomes critical. Oak Park’s multiple homeowner associations maintain specific pre-approved lists for garage door panel style, window placement, and finish color. A beautifully installed door in the wrong profile or shade generates a compliance letter within weeks. We verify HOA requirements before ordering and source Clopay and Amarr panels in profiles that match existing approvals. Sometimes a single dented panel can be swapped. Sometimes the HOA’s color palette has shifted and a full door replacement is the only compliant path.

Cable Repair
Cable repair costs $155-$295. Frayed or snapped lift cables are dangerous, and we treat them that way. The high-tension environment of a loaded torsion system can cause serious injury without proper tools and training. If you see a hanging cable or a door that lifts unevenly, don’t attempt a DIY fix. We’ll match cable length and drum wind to your specific door weight and spring configuration.

Common Garage Door Repair Problems We See in Oak Park Homes
- Original torsion springs reaching end of life. The 30-to-40-year-old springs in Oak Park’s housing stock are fracturing in clusters. We replace them with upgraded cycle-life springs that outlast the originals.
- Santa Ana wind events torquing track alignment. Every fall and winter, wind gusts through the valley corridor knock two-car doors out of square. The fix is mechanical realignment, not a new door.
- HOA rejection of non-compliant repairs. Technicians who skip the HOA step get their customers cited. We verify pre-approved panel profiles, window arrangements, and colors before any replacement work begins.
- Dry-heat weatherstripping failure. Oak Park’s low-humidity fire-weather days crack rubber seals faster than coastal climates. Cracked weatherstripping lets dust, heat, and debris accelerate wear on springs and openers.
Pricing for Garage Door Repair in Oak Park, CA
Most garage door repairs in Oak Park fall between $175 and $710. The table below shows line-item ranges for the work we perform most often in 91377. These are real numbers for your market, not teaser rates that balloon on arrival.
| Service | Price Range in Oak Park |
|---|---|
| Spring Repair | $180-$340 |
| Cable Repair | $155-$295 |
| Track Realignment | $120-$240 |
| Panel Replacement | $250-$500 |
| Opener Repair | $140-$380 |
| Roller Replacement | $130-$260 |
| Opener Installation | $295-$650 |
| New Door Installation | $825-$2,595 |
What moves a job toward the higher end? Multiple simultaneous failures on an original system, HOA-mandated panel profiles that require special ordering, or structural rot in the jamb that needs reframing before track hardware can mount securely.
